Course Content

• Understanding Trade Finance Fundamentals for Nonprofits
• Letters of Credit (LCs) and their Application in Nonprofit Trade
• Documentary Collections: Streamlining Nonprofit Imports/Exports
• Supply Chain Finance & its Impact on Nonprofit Operations
• Risk Management in Nonprofit Trade Finance: Mitigation Strategies
• Negotiating Favorable Trade Finance Terms for Nonprofits
• Trade Finance Regulations & Compliance for Nonprofits
• Case Studies: Successful Trade Finance Initiatives in the Nonprofit Sector
